Mot clé Risques Politique/planification Gouvernance Évaluation/gestion des risques Institution Aire géographique Amériques, Arctique, Asie et Pacifique, Pacifique du Est, Amérique du Nord, Atlantique Nord Résumé The present Act provides for the establishment of emergency plans by municipalities. This also empowers Councils to be responsible for the direction and control of a municipal emergency response (to take action to implement the plan and to protect the property, health, safety and welfare of the public). Section 4 provides for the establishment of the Provincial Committee. This Committee shall: a) prepare an emergency plan for Saskatchewan, for approval by the Minister, governing: i) the provision of necessary services during an emergency; and ii) the procedures under and the manner in which persons will respond to an emergency; and b) advise the Minister respecting emergency planning matters.
